1. Meals Particles Accumulation
Meals particles accumulation inside a dishwasher is a main issue contributing to the technology of malodors, particularly a scent usually likened to damp canine fur. Meals particles, trapped in crevices, the filter, spray arms, and the underside of the equipment, endure decomposition. This course of releases risky natural compounds (VOCs), lots of which possess disagreeable odors. The composition of the trapped meals fat, proteins, and carbohydrates dictates the particular VOCs produced, and the general olfactory profile.
Take into account, for instance, residual meat fat clinging to the dishwasher’s inside. As these fat decompose, they produce rancid, musty odors. Equally, starchy meals remnants, corresponding to pasta or rice, can ferment and domesticate mildew development, including a bitter and earthy element to the general scent. The longer these particles stay inside the damp surroundings, the extra pronounced the offensive scent turns into.
Due to this fact, addressing meals particles accumulation by common cleansing and upkeep is essential for mitigating the supply of the malodor. Eradicating trapped meals particles prevents decomposition and the next launch of disagreeable VOCs, straight addressing the foundation explanation for the “moist canine” scent emanating from the dishwasher. Common rinsing of plates, scraping off any residue earlier than loading, cleansing the filter commonly, will show you how to to mitigate the difficulty.
2. Bacterial/Mildew Development
The proliferation of micro organism and mildew inside a dishwasher is a major contributor to the event of disagreeable odors, usually characterised as resembling damp canine fur. The nice and cozy, humid surroundings inside a dishwasher, coupled with the presence of meals residues, creates a super breeding floor for these microorganisms. Their metabolic processes generate risky natural compounds (VOCs) which might be accountable for the offensive scent.
-
Biofilm Formation
Micro organism and mildew readily kind biofilms on the surfaces inside a dishwasher. Biofilms are advanced communities of microorganisms encased in a self-produced matrix of extracellular polymeric substances (EPS). These biofilms shield the organisms from cleansing brokers and permit them to persist even after a wash cycle. The EPS matrix traps meals particles, additional fueling microbial development and VOC manufacturing. As an illustration, Pseudomonas species, generally present in dishwashers, can produce a musty, earthy odor as a part of their metabolic exercise inside a biofilm.
-
Species Variety
The precise varieties of micro organism and mildew current in a dishwasher affect the character of the odor. Completely different species produce totally different VOCs. Some micro organism, corresponding to sure Bacillus strains, produce amines, which have a fishy or ammonia-like scent. Molds, like Aspergillus or Penicillium, generate a variety of VOCs, together with geosmin (earthy) and 2-methylisoborneol (musty). The advanced interaction of those totally different VOCs creates a particular and sometimes disagreeable odor profile.
-
Affect of Temperature and Humidity
Elevated temperatures and excessive humidity ranges speed up the expansion and metabolic exercise of micro organism and mildew. Dishwashers, by design, present these situations. The warmth from the wash and drying cycles creates an ideal incubator for microorganisms to thrive. Moreover, the humidity permits for the dispersal of spores and bacterial cells, facilitating colonization of recent areas inside the equipment. Decrease temperature cycles, whereas power environment friendly, could not successfully kill these organisms, resulting in their persistent development.
-
Materials Susceptibility
Sure supplies generally utilized in dishwashers, corresponding to plastic and rubber, are extra prone to microbial colonization than others. These supplies can present a porous floor for biofilms to stick to and shield the microorganisms from cleansing brokers. Moreover, some plastics can leach chemical substances that function vitamins for micro organism and mildew, selling their development. The degradation of those supplies by microbial exercise may also contribute to the general malodor.
In conclusion, bacterial and mildew development are pivotal in understanding the origin of the offensive scent from dishwashers. The formation of biofilms, the variety of microbial species, the conducive temperature and humidity, and the fabric susceptibility all contribute to the manufacturing of disagreeable VOCs. Addressing these elements by common cleansing, disinfection, and correct upkeep is important for eliminating the supply of the odor and sustaining a hygienic dishwashing surroundings.
3. Insufficient Air flow
Inadequate airflow inside a dishwasher considerably contributes to the event of offensive odors. Correct air flow is essential for eradicating moisture and stopping the expansion of odor-causing microorganisms. With out ample airflow, the equipment turns into a breeding floor for micro organism and mildew, leading to an disagreeable scent usually described as much like that of damp canine fur.
-
Moisture Retention
Insufficient air flow traps moisture inside the dishwasher after a wash cycle. This persistent dampness creates a super surroundings for microbial proliferation. The trapped water permits micro organism and mildew to thrive on meals residues, resulting in the decomposition of natural matter and the next launch of risky natural compounds (VOCs) accountable for the offensive odor. Standing water within the backside of the dishwasher is a first-rate instance of this impact.
-
Promotion of Microbial Development
The nice and cozy, humid situations fostered by poor air flow encourage the speedy development of assorted microorganisms. Mildew spores and micro organism thrive in these environments, forming colonies and biofilms on the inside surfaces of the dishwasher. These microbial communities contribute to the persistent odor drawback. Species like Pseudomonas and numerous molds, frequent in dishwashers, are identified to supply musty and earthy scents, exacerbating the general disagreeable scent.
-
Impeded Drying Course of
Efficient drying is important for stopping odor buildup. Inadequate air flow hinders the drying course of, prolonging the period of dampness contained in the dishwasher. The extended dampness gives prolonged alternatives for microbial development and VOC manufacturing. Dishwashers missing a correct vent or these with obstructed vents are significantly prone to this subject. Even dishwashers with a heating ingredient for drying may be much less efficient if air flow is poor, because the moisture can not escape simply.
-
Affect on Cleansing Agent Effectiveness
The effectiveness of cleansing brokers may be compromised by insufficient air flow. If the inside of the dishwasher stays excessively humid, cleansing brokers could not have the ability to absolutely dry and exert their antimicrobial results. This decreased efficacy permits micro organism and mildew to outlive and proceed producing odors. Moreover, some cleansing brokers could themselves degrade in humid situations, contributing to further disagreeable smells. Utilizing a rinse support might help by selling quicker drying, however it’s not an alternative choice to correct air flow.
The dearth of ample airflow inside a dishwasher straight fosters an surroundings conducive to microbial development and the next manufacturing of offensive odors. Addressing air flow points by correct upkeep, making certain vents are clear, and contemplating the usage of drying brokers can considerably mitigate the difficulty. Correct air flow not solely prevents odor formation but additionally enhances the general hygiene and efficiency of the equipment.
4. Filter Neglect
Dishwasher filter neglect straight correlates with the emanation of disagreeable odors, usually described as much like damp canine fur, from the equipment. Common filter upkeep is important to forestall the buildup of meals particles and the next proliferation of odor-causing microorganisms.
-
Meals Particle Accumulation and Decomposition
A uncared for dishwasher filter turns into a repository for meals particles starting from small crumbs to bigger scraps. As these particles decompose inside the heat, moist surroundings of the dishwasher, they launch risky natural compounds (VOCs). These VOCs are the first contributors to the foul scent related to a poorly maintained equipment. For instance, trapped grease can flip rancid, whereas decaying vegetable matter ferments, every course of producing distinct and offensive odors.
-
Microbial Proliferation
The buildup of meals particles inside the filter gives a super breeding floor for micro organism and mildew. These microorganisms thrive on the natural matter, forming biofilms and releasing byproducts that contribute to the disagreeable scent. Species corresponding to Pseudomonas and numerous molds are generally present in uncared for dishwasher filters, producing musty, earthy, and typically sulfurous odors.
-
Impeded Water Circulation and Cleansing Effectivity
A clogged filter restricts water circulation inside the dishwasher, lowering its total cleansing effectivity. This decreased effectivity results in extra meals particles remaining on dishes and inside the equipment, additional exacerbating the odor drawback. Diminished water circulation additionally hinders the efficient distribution of detergent, permitting meals residues to persist and contribute to the disagreeable scent.
-
Contribution to System-Huge Contamination
A uncared for filter can function a supply of contamination for the complete dishwasher system. Microorganisms and meals particles may be flushed from the clogged filter into different elements of the equipment, corresponding to spray arms and water traces. This contamination spreads the odor and might compromise the cleanliness of subsequent wash cycles. The recirculated contaminated water basically distributes the supply of the scent, prolonging and intensifying the issue.
Consequently, sustaining a clear dishwasher filter is paramount in stopping the buildup of meals particles, inhibiting microbial development, and making certain optimum equipment efficiency. Common cleansing of the filter is a simple but essential step in mitigating the “moist canine” odor and sustaining a hygienic dishwashing surroundings. Failure to handle filter upkeep invariably results in the persistence and intensification of disagreeable odors, finally impacting the general cleanliness and sanitation of the equipment.
5. Seal Deterioration
Deteriorated seals inside a dishwasher contribute considerably to the event of disagreeable odors, mirroring the scent of damp canine fur. Dishwasher seals, sometimes constructed from rubber or silicone, serve to create a watertight barrier, stopping leaks and sustaining optimum water stress throughout wash cycles. When these seals degrade, their compromised integrity fosters an surroundings conducive to microbial development and the buildup of stagnant water, finally resulting in the offensive scent.
Particularly, cracked, warped, or brittle seals permit water to seep into areas not designed for normal cleansing and drying, such because the area between the internal tub and the outer casing. This trapped water, usually laden with meals particles, turns into a breeding floor for micro organism and mildew. The anaerobic situations inside these confined areas promote the expansion of odor-producing microorganisms. For instance, mildew species like Aspergillus and micro organism corresponding to Pseudomonas, generally present in such environments, launch risky natural compounds (VOCs) accountable for the musty, earthy odors related to seal deterioration. Moreover, the degraded seal materials itself can develop into a substrate for microbial colonization, exacerbating the odor drawback. The decreased seal additionally means it is going to be much less efficient in preserving detergent and rinse support inside the primary wash space. This will trigger points with the general cleansing efficiency of the dishwasher.
In conclusion, seal deterioration represents a crucial issue within the growth of malodors inside a dishwasher. The compromised barrier permits for water and meals particle accumulation in inaccessible areas, fostering microbial development and the next launch of offensive VOCs. Addressing seal deterioration by inspection and well timed alternative is essential for mitigating the “moist canine” scent and sustaining a sanitary dishwashing surroundings. Common checks and immediate motion will stop additional degradation and protect the equipment’s hygiene.
6. Water Stagnation
Water stagnation inside a dishwasher is a major contributor to the event of disagreeable odors, usually described as resembling damp canine fur. When water stays pooled within the equipment after a wash cycle, significantly within the sump space, the underside of the bathtub, or inside the filter housing, it creates an surroundings conducive to bacterial and fungal development. This stagnant water acts as a breeding floor, facilitating the decomposition of residual meals particles and the next launch of risky natural compounds (VOCs). These VOCs are straight accountable for the offensive scent. Take into account, for example, a dishwasher with {a partially} blocked drain line. The ensuing water stagnation gives an incubator for anaerobic micro organism, which thrive in oxygen-deprived situations and produce hydrogen sulfide, a gasoline with a attribute rotten egg odor that contributes to the general malodor profile.
The hyperlink between water stagnation and odor technology is additional amplified by the supplies utilized in dishwasher development. Plastic and rubber parts, corresponding to seals and hoses, can soak up and retain moisture, exacerbating the issue. If stagnant water stays in touch with these supplies for prolonged durations, microbial biofilms can kind, making a persistent supply of odor even after the water is drained. Low water temperatures throughout wash cycles may also worsen the difficulty. Insufficiently heated water fails to successfully sanitize the dishwasher inside, permitting micro organism and fungi to outlive and thrive within the stagnant swimming pools. The sensible significance lies in recognizing that stopping water stagnation by correct drainage and ample water temperature is paramount to sustaining a hygienic dishwasher.
In abstract, water stagnation gives the required situations for microbial proliferation and the discharge of offensive VOCs, straight contributing to the “moist canine” scent usually related to dishwashers. Addressing this subject requires making certain correct drainage, utilizing applicable water temperatures, and commonly cleansing the equipment to take away residual meals particles and forestall biofilm formation. Stopping water stagnation is crucial for mitigating odor points and sustaining the general cleanliness and sanitation of the dishwasher.
7. Low Water Temperature
Suboptimal water temperature throughout dishwasher cycles straight contributes to the event of disagreeable odors, usually characterised by a scent paying homage to damp canine fur. Inadequate warmth impairs the efficacy of detergents and sanitizing brokers, hindering the removing of meals residues and the eradication of odor-causing microorganisms. The result’s a conducive surroundings for bacterial and fungal proliferation, resulting in the emission of risky natural compounds (VOCs) accountable for the offensive scent. As an illustration, grease and fat, which require increased temperatures to emulsify and dissolve, are likely to cling to dishwasher parts when uncovered to low-temperature cycles. This residual grease turns into a breeding floor for micro organism, contributing to the malodor.
The affect of insufficient warmth extends past easy cleansing. Many fashionable dishwashers incorporate energy-saving options, together with decreased water temperatures. Whereas helpful for conserving power, these decrease temperatures can compromise sanitation if not correctly balanced with applicable detergent utilization and cycle period. A sensible instance is the usage of eco-friendly detergents, which can require increased water temperatures to activate their full cleansing potential. Moreover, low-temperature cycles could not successfully kill heat-resistant micro organism or fungi, permitting them to thrive and contribute to the persistent odor. The importance right here lies in understanding the interaction between water temperature, detergent effectiveness, and the hygienic state of the dishwasher.
In abstract, low water temperature undermines the power of a dishwasher to successfully clear and sanitize, fostering an surroundings ripe for microbial development and the technology of offensive odors. Recognizing this connection is essential for optimizing dishwasher settings, deciding on applicable detergents, and implementing preventative upkeep methods to mitigate the “moist canine” scent. Common use of a dishwasher cleaner, working a high-temperature cycle periodically, and making certain the right functioning of the heating ingredient are sensible steps towards sustaining a hygienic and odor-free equipment.

Query 1: What are the first causes of the “moist canine” scent in a dishwasher?
The first causes embrace meals particles accumulation, bacterial and mildew development, insufficient air flow, a uncared for filter, seal deterioration, water stagnation, and low water temperature throughout wash cycles. These elements create an surroundings conducive to microbial exercise and the discharge of offensive risky natural compounds.
Query 2: How usually ought to a dishwasher filter be cleaned to forestall odors?
The dishwasher filter needs to be cleaned no less than as soon as a month, or extra continuously if there’s seen meals particles accumulation. Common cleansing prevents the buildup of natural matter that fuels microbial development and odor manufacturing.
Query 3: Can utilizing extra detergent remedy the odor drawback?
Utilizing extra detergent shouldn’t be an answer to the odor drawback. Overuse of detergent can result in residue buildup and should exacerbate the difficulty. It is very important use the beneficial quantity of detergent and deal with the underlying causes of the odor.
Query 4: Is it essential to name knowledgeable to handle the “moist canine” scent?
In lots of circumstances, the “moist canine” scent may be resolved by thorough cleansing and upkeep. Nonetheless, if the odor persists after addressing the frequent causes, or if there are indicators of serious mechanical points, consulting a professional equipment restore technician is beneficial.
Query 5: Do sure varieties of meals contribute extra to dishwasher odors?
Sure, sure varieties of meals, significantly these excessive in fat, proteins, and starches, contribute extra considerably to dishwasher odors. These residues present a wealthy nutrient supply for micro organism and mildew, resulting in elevated risky natural compound manufacturing.
Query 6: How can ample air flow be ensured in a dishwasher?
Satisfactory air flow may be ensured by preserving the dishwasher door barely ajar after a cycle to permit moisture to flee. Moreover, making certain that any vents will not be obstructed and utilizing a rinse support to advertise drying can enhance air flow.

Eliminating and Stopping Dishwasher Odors
The next suggestions define sensible steps for eradicating current odors and stopping their recurrence, making certain a clear and hygienic dishwashing surroundings.
Tip 1: Completely Clear the Dishwasher Filter
Take away the dishwasher filter and rinse it underneath scorching water. Use a smooth brush to take away any trapped meals particles. If closely dirty, soak the filter in an answer of vinegar and water earlier than scrubbing. Reinstall the clear filter securely.
Tip 2: Run a Vinegar Cycle
Place a dishwasher-safe cup stuffed with white vinegar on the highest rack of the empty dishwasher. Run a standard cycle on excessive warmth. The vinegar will assist dissolve grease, take away mineral deposits, and neutralize odors.
Tip 3: Clear the Dishwasher Inside with Baking Soda
Sprinkle a cup of baking soda throughout the underside of the empty dishwasher. Run a brief, cold-water cycle. Baking soda helps soak up lingering odors and freshen the equipment.
Tip 4: Examine and Clear the Spray Arms
Take away the spray arms and examine for any clogs within the nozzles. Use a toothpick or skinny wire to clear any obstructions. Rinse the spray arms completely earlier than reattaching them.
Tip 5: Handle Seal Deterioration
Examine the dishwasher seals for cracks, harm, or particles. Clear the seals with a humid material and delicate detergent. If seals are considerably deteriorated, contemplate changing them to forestall water leakage and microbial development.
Tip 6: Guarantee Correct Air flow
After every cycle, depart the dishwasher door barely ajar to permit moisture to flee. This promotes drying and prevents the buildup of humidity, which fosters microbial development.
Tip 7: Make the most of Excessive-Temperature Wash Cycles
Periodically run the dishwasher on the most popular setting to sanitize the inside and eradicate micro organism and mildew. Be certain that the water heater is about to a ample temperature for optimum cleansing efficiency.
Constant implementation of those preventative measures will considerably scale back the probability of disagreeable odors and preserve a clear and hygienic dishwashing equipment. By addressing meals particles, selling correct sanitation, and making certain ample air flow, the dishwasher will stay free from offensive smells.
